Processor Power and Type
The processor power and type in a renewed Mac Studio are crucial factors that directly impact performance. The chips available, such as the M4, M4 Pro, or M4 Max, vary in core counts and capabilities. The M4 Pro, with a 12-core CPU and 16-core GPU, handles demanding tasks like video editing and 3D rendering with ease. The M4 Max offers even more power, featuring up to a 36-core GPU, making it ideal for intensive content creation and large-scale coding. The generation of the processor influences overall speed, multitasking, and compatibility with resource-heavy applications. Choosing a higher-core processor means faster processing times and smoother performance under load. This makes the processor type a key consideration when selecting a renewed Mac Studio tailored to your professional needs.

Storage Size Choices
Deciding on the right storage size for your renewed Mac Studio depends largely on your data needs and budget. If you handle moderate tasks like web browsing, document editing, or light media, 512GB might be sufficient. However, if you work with high-resolution media files, large software libraries, or plan for future growth, consider options up to 8TB. Larger capacities like 1TB or 2TB offer plenty of space for demanding projects and can save you from external drives. Keep in mind that storage upgrade costs vary, so choose a size that fits your budget. Additionally, opt for faster SSD storage to improve data access and transfer speeds, boosting overall productivity and efficiency.

Can Renewed Mac Studios Be Upgraded or Customized After Purchase?
Renewed Mac Studios are generally not designed for extensive upgrades or customization after purchase. Apple tightly controls hardware modifications, so you can’t easily swap out components like RAM or storage. However, you can customize some settings and software to optimize performance. If upgradeability is a priority, consider purchasing a new model with the specifications you need, since renewed units focus more on affordability and reliability than on future upgrades.
